
Via a post on the NCISverse’s Instagram page, the franchise announced that LL Cool J is returning for NCIS season 22. He will appear alongside Parker’s (Gary Cole) MCRT, likely aiding in solving a case. No additional information was given about his part in the show, but it is safe to assume that he will be reprising his role as Sam Hanna, one of NCIS: Los Angeles’ best characters.
This will not be the first time that LL Cool J has appeared in the flagship, as Sam has been a regular guest star on the show ever since NCIS’ first crossover with NCIS: Los Angeles. While he usually appears with the rest of his team, it is not unusual for him to do a crossover event alone. Sam has particularly been a helpful ally to the NCIS team as he has used his unique skills of being both a special agent and former Navy SEAL to aid the team in solving their cases.

From NCIS: LA to NCIS Main — How We Got Here
A Bittersweet Goodbye
NCIS: Los Angeles wrapped in 2023 after 14 action-packed seasons. Fans said goodbye to Sam Hanna, not knowing if we’d ever see him again.
The Crossover That Changed Everything
But in 2023, Sam made a surprise appearance in NCIS: Hawai’i, hinting that he might not be gone for good. That tease now pays off with NCIS Season 22 welcoming him back.
